This case study outlines MIRA’s innovative approach to addressing elect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) challenges in the automotive sector using CADfix, a data interoperability tool. MIRA, a contract-engineering organization, aims to streamline the complex data involved in automotive engineering through advanced simulation and analysis techniques. As the automotive industry shifts towards more simulation-based product development, MIRA emphasizes the importance of having a variety of design and analysis services. The document details how CADfix enables MIRA to efficiently extract and manipulate data from various CAD systems, facilitating better analysis and simulation for EMC. The case study further explains the specific geometry and meshing requirements necessary for EMC analysis, which differ from other engineering disciplines. MIRA anticipates a growing impact of EMC on vehicle design due to the increasing reliance on electronic components. This evolution will enhance the interior layout considerations of vehicles as electronic complexities rise.
